Deekshaa Singh Chauhan Ответов: 0

Как решить :используйте раздел, зарегистрированный как allowdefinition='machinetoapplication' за пределами уровня приложения.


У меня есть веб-приложение с именем job portal. когда я строю этот проект он показывает ошибку приведенную ниже :
Использование раздела, зарегистрированного как allowDefinition='MachineToApplication' за пределами уровня приложения, является ошибкой. Эта ошибка может быть вызвана тем, что виртуальный каталог не настроен как приложение в IIS. C:\dev\demo-jobportal-com-APPLICATION\web\web.config 98

И когда я открываю другую страницу она теперь показывает дизайн вид здесь показать ошибку "Ошибка главной страницы"и учитывая код просмотра, когда я просматриваю код здесь, он указывает, что строка 1t моей страницы является:
<%@ page title="" language="C#" masterpagefile="~/MasterPages/SiteMaster.master" autoeventwireup="true" inherits="Login, App_Web_login.aspx.cdcab7d2" theme="ThemeGlobal" %>


Что я уже пробовал:

Я не знаю ,что я могу сделать, я не понимаю, где здесь проблема.
пожалуйста, помогите мне..

Richard Deeming

"Эта ошибка может быть вызвана тем, что виртуальный каталог не настроен как приложение в IIS."

Таким образом, либо вы настроили свой проект в IIS как виртуальный каталог вместо приложения, либо добавили параметр уровня приложения в web.config файл, который не находится в корне вашего проекта.

Если это первое, то откройте Диспетчер IIS, щелкните правой кнопкой мыши папку вашего проекта и выберите пункт "преобразовать в приложение".

Если это последнее, то вам нужно будет отредактировать web.config файл для удаления ошибочной настройки.

Deekshaa Singh Chauhan

это не работает,
На самом деле это веб-приложение было опубликовано.

0 Ответов